Can you build a successful music career without a day job?

It’s simply not possible to build a successful music career if you spend every moment of your free time exhausted because you work all day (at a non-musical job). How can I break free of my day job and music career?

One way to break free of your day job and start working full time on your music career is to develop a strategy for smoothly transitioning from one to the other. For example, you could reduce the hours you spend at your day job from 40 per week to 35 and spend the extra 5 hours working on your music career.

How to become a full-time musician?

This transition into a full-time musician is a process so make sure you have ways of sustaining yourself. You can put a day job to work for your future by interning or working in a position related to music (venues, labels, music schools, etc). Even teaching music as a side gig to supplement income could help as well.
